When will the Iran war end? The US can’t even decide when it began (opens in new tab)

A state department document seeks to justify the war as part of a years-long conflictIs the war in Iran over? Within hours of secretary of state Marco Rubio’s assurance that “the operation is over” last week, Donald Trump used social media to declare that it most decidedly was not. Should Iran fail to accept the US peace plan, Trump warned that the bombing would resume and “at a much higher level and intensity than it was before”.
